Mike Cooper & Grayson Cooke

Grayson Cooke is an interdisciplinary scholar and award-winning media artist, Senior Lecturer in the School of Arts and Social Sciences at Southern Cross University, and Course Coordinator of the Bachelor of Media degree. Grayson has presented live audio-visual performance works in Australia, New Zealand, Spain, Italy, Japan and the UK, and he has published academic articles in numerous print and online journals. He holds an interdisciplinary PhD from Concordia University in Montreal. Mike Cooper plays lap steel guitar / electronics and sings. For the past 40 years he has been an international musical explorer pushing the boundaries of his music. He ranges freely through his own idiosyncratic original songs, traditional country blues, folk, free improvisation, pop songs, exotica, electronic music, and sonic gestural playing utilizing open tunings and extended guitar techniques. He appears on more than 80 records to date and runs his own HIPSHOT record label on which he publishes most of his solo work these days.
